FFDPF Armed Forces Abbreviation

FFDPF has various meanings in the Armed Forces category. Discover the full forms, definitions, and usage contexts of FFDPF in Armed Forces.

Free French Desert Patrol Flight
Armed Forces

Citation

Last updated: